For the sweetest, best tasting apple juice, use the ripest apples you can find. Bruised apples are okay, but only if you cut out the bruises. Rome, Gala, Red Delicious, and Fuji apples are the best to use due to their sweet juice.

If your children turn up their noses at vegetables, try juicing them. It can be difficult to get children to eat vegetables. So instead of forcing the vegetables on them, you can juice some fruits as well as vegetables and combine the juices. They will enjoy drinking the juice and not even realize that they are consuming vegetables.

Ginger is a great food that can help to aid gastrointestinal problems. It can be added to the juice you make to give it a little pop and make you feel better at the same time. It is a great anti-inflammatory agent which can aid in healing the esophageal reaction to acid reflux, or stomach ulcers and upset.

Make your juice and then drink it immediately. In order to get the best juice, it is very important to note that nutrients from the juice are lost once the juice is made. The longer your juice is stored, the more degradation of nutrients will occur. You should drink any juice you make as soon as it is done.
A masticating juicer is the best choice for the beginner or expert alike. Masticating juicers have special features, such as the ability to mill, grind, and puree. Such features add an extra element to the exciting types of juices you can make.

Cucumber juice is helpful for maintaining healthy hair and skin. Cucumbers have a high silica content. Silica also strengthens connective tissue and is good for muscles, bones, ligaments and tendons.
